Frequently Asked Questions

Common questions about mortgage lending in Paulina, LA

Are there any first-time homebuyer programs specific to Paulina, LA that can help with down payment assistance?

While Paulina itself doesn't offer city-specific programs, St. James Parish residents can access the Louisiana Housing Corporation's mortgage programs, including the Market Rate GNMA Program which offers competitive interest rates and down payment assistance for eligible first-time buyers. These programs are particularly valuable given Paulina's affordable housing market compared to larger Louisiana cities.

What are typical mortgage rates available for Paulina homebuyers compared to national averages?

Paulina mortgage rates typically align with Louisiana state averages, which often run slightly higher than national rates due to local economic factors. Currently, rates in the River Parishes region range from 6.5% to 7.25% for conventional 30-year fixed loans, though local credit unions like Neighbors Federal Credit Union sometimes offer more competitive rates to area residents.

How does Paulina's location in a flood zone affect mortgage requirements and insurance costs?

Most Paulina properties require flood insurance due to the community's proximity to the Mississippi River and location in Flood Zone AE. Lenders will mandate this coverage, typically adding $500-$1,200 annually to your housing costs. It's crucial to factor this into your budget when determining mortgage affordability in this riverside community.

What unique mortgage considerations should I know about when buying older homes in historic Paulina?

Many Paulina homes date from the early to mid-20th century, so lenders may require additional inspections for older properties, particularly checking for outdated electrical systems, plumbing, or foundation issues common in this area. Some renovation loans like the FHA 203(k) can be beneficial for updating these character-rich homes while keeping them affordable.

Are there any local credit unions or banks in Paulina that offer special mortgage terms for residents?

Several regional institutions serving Paulina, like Resource Bank and Neighbors Federal Credit Union, often provide relationship discounts or special programs for local homebuyers. These local lenders typically have better understanding of Paulina's unique property values and can offer more personalized service than national banks for this small community.

Finding Your Perfect Home Loan Partner in Paulina, Louisiana

Searching for "home loan lenders near me" is more than just finding a convenient location; it's about connecting with financial partners who understand the unique heartbeat of the Paulina community. As a potential homebuyer in this special part of Louisiana's River Parishes, your journey to homeownership comes with distinct opportunities and considerations that a local expert can help you navigate.

Paulina's housing market offers a appealing mix of quiet, residential living with strong community ties, all while being within a manageable commute to major employment centers in Baton Rouge and the River Parishes industrial corridor. This positioning affects both home values and the type of mortgage advice you need. A lender based in nearby Lutcher, Gramercy, or LaPlace isn't just close geographically; they inherently understand the appraisal values in our neighborhoods, the resilience of our property markets, and the true costs of homeownership here, including Louisiana's unique insurance landscape.

When evaluating local lenders, don't just compare interest rates. Sit down with them and ask pointed questions about their experience with properties in St. James Parish. How do they handle the often-necessary flood insurance requirements, which are a critical factor in many parts of our region? A seasoned local loan officer can preemptively guide you on these additional costs, ensuring your budget is accurate from the start. They can also provide invaluable referrals to local home inspectors and title companies familiar with the area's specific needs.

One of your most significant advantages as a Louisiana homebuyer is access to state-specific programs that out-of-state online lenders might not proactively offer. The Louisiana Mortgage Corporation (LMC) offers first-time homebuyer programs with competitive rates and down payment assistance. Furthermore, the Louisiana Housing Corporation (LHC) provides mortgages with down payment assistance for eligible buyers, which can be a game-changer. A local lender who regularly works with these programs can efficiently walk you through the eligibility requirements and application process, smoothing your path to approval.
